With several Class 115 DMU sets ticking-over under the overall roof, Driving Motor Brake Second M51671 was stood at the former Great Central terminus at Marylebone with a service to Aylesbury on October 23rd 1979. These Derby built 'Suburban' high-density Class 115 4-Car DMU's with doors to every seating bay, were commonplace on services to and from Marylebone from being new in 1960 until the final examples were replaced by 'Turbos' in 1992. Martyn Hilbert.

A Marylebone-bound class 115 DMU calls at Gerrards Cross in May 1980. The line was opened in 1906, a joint venture built by the Great Western & Great Central Railways. The line through here was rebuilt towards the end of the 1980s and became double track, with the platform extended over the two right-hand lines. Kevin Lane.
